An Ebonyi State business man and chief executive officer of Olu and Sons Enterprises, a firm that majors in the business of granite, chippings and trucks.  Mr Olu Ernest Ndukwe, popular known as Yar’adua has cried out to the Ebonyi StateState Commiss of Police, Awosola Awotunde, Ebonyi State Government and other relevant agencies to come to his rescue immediately as a group of individuals are threatening to kill him and take over his business.

Narrating his ordeal to journalists in Abakaliki, the Ebonyi State capital, Mr. Ndukwe said the whole incident started on 14th of June, 2019.

“I was in my office around past 4pm in the evening when a group of boys came to my garage, chased away my workers and one Mr. Albert Umeh Okorie, Innocent Chukwu, Augustine Eke Ajah, Solomon Ogbonnaya (a.k.a OTENKWU), Emenike Ajah, Ebere Ajah, Ezeogwu (a.k.a AA). They stormed my garage with all manner of weapons, took 500 thousand naira from my office and also stole tires and other valuable things in the office. After the attack, when they pushed me out of office, I hid somewhere, where I took pictures of them with weapons”.

 

He continued thus

“I called the D.P.O. to inform him of what happened and the need to arrest those people. The only thing he told me was that the people also destroyed his own Hilux while they were having problems somewhere”.

According to him, the Divisional Police Officer (D.P.O) incharge of Ivo Divisional Police Station, Ebonyi State, Gabriel Urom did not make any arrest to that effect. Then “on Sunday morning being 16th of the same month, that’s after two days, I was preparing to go to church, when I sighted from a distance this same group of boys and others with all manner of weapons; guns, machetes, chain, axe and other things pointing towards my church and where I used to park my car. On sensing danger, I went back to the house. About after 11am, that same Sunday morning, they stormed the church with some weapons, going roll by roll in Assemblies of God Church, Amaokwe, in Ishiagu, Ivo Local Government Area. So, they came searching for me inside the church. By that time we were in worship session. My family were in church already. They were raising people who were worshipping one by one looking for me.

This incident, Mr. Ndukwe noted made his Pastor to confront them and queried who they were looking for him and the guys replied that they must kill him (Mr. Ndukwe). He said, it was then that the Pastor quickly called the D.P.O, who also sent a van with a team of Police but he regretted that the Police came and met the people within the church premises instead of arresting them, the Police just asked them to leave the church.

He said

“then I now called the D.P.O, who came to my hiding place and took me to the station where I made entry that Sunday. After making entry, the D.P.O assured me that he was going to arrest them. I also gave their pictures”.

Mr. Ernest Ndukwe alleged that the D.P.O, Mr. Gabriel Urom knows them very well but has consistently shown unwillingness to arrest them. He continued thus “So, by 3:30pm that same Sunday, they came back to my garage, because the first one they destroyed 3 trucks after stealing my money. So on that Sunday when they came, they chased away both the security and other staff . They came with all manner of weapons and destroyed 6 more trucks”, this he said included his newest trucks and windscreen. He said even after making entry of threat to his life, in which the D.P.O sent the D.C.O who came and meet those guys destroying his property, they were not arrested, rather in the night those criminal elements kidnapped one of the drivers and mandated the driver to disguise and call to find out his location, luckly enough, Mr. Ndukwe had left for Enugu that night and told the driver that he was not within.

However, he later had access to the Deputy Commissioner of Police, who took actions that led to the arrest of 5 persons out of which two were not part of those that destroyed his vehicles.
When press men tried to find out the possible reason behind the threat of life to the business man, he said he can’t relate it to any thing apart from unnecessary envy against him by the young men , who he said are from Okwe whereas himself is from Amaokwe in the same Ishiagu, Ivo LGA. He further said that
“These people are not members of my union neither am I having any problem with them ” and worries why they should be after his life”.

He equally informed that he does business with a quarry company known as Pioneer Shining Cino Investment while the boys have been approaching a new company that
that deals on quarry sites – Chruch Rocked Industry Nig. limited and have been fighting for these companies to include them to be benefiting as land owners of the sites.

Mr. Ernest Ndukwe, who sensed compromise on the part of the Police officers had already sued his traitors to court and the case was supposed to come up on 17th July but has been shifted to a date to be communicated later. His greatest fear now is that they have threatened to kill him on the day they would be appearing in court “they threatened that on the day of the court, that they are going to kill me along the road. That somebody has assured them that they would say it is riot. That nothing would happen and Police is by their side. That Police wouldn’t do anything”.

He requests government to save his life, family and business from his traitors, whom he said have conspired to kill him.

Efforts to reach the State Police Command for comments as at the time of this report proved abortive.
